What is a Baby Bedside Sleeper?
A bedside sleeper, also known as a co-sleeper, is a type of infant bed developed to connect securely to the side of an adult bed. It permits parents to keep their baby close during the night while promoting safe sleeping practices. These sleepers typically feature features like adjustable height, removable sides, and breathable products that assist keep babies protect and comfortable.

A: Yes, as long as they adhere to safety requirements and standards. Make certain the model is steady, securely connected to your bed, and ideal for your baby's age and weight.
Q2: How long can my baby sleep in a bedside sleeper?
A: Most bedside sleepers are developed for infants approximately 6 months or until they can rise on their hands and knees. Always follow the manufacturer's guidelines.
Q3: Can I use a bedside sleeper in location of a crib?
A: Bedside sleepers are not a permanent replacement for a crib. They are best utilized for short-term, close sleeping arrangements throughout infancy.
Q4: How do I clean up a bedside sleeper?
A: Many designs provide removable and machine-washable covers for easy cleansing. Make certain to follow the maker's directions for care and upkeep.
